Opportunities to Shine at St. Luke's
Shining a star ... opportunities to flourish and grow
At St. Luke's, we encourage our children to showcase their talents in a variety of ways.
Here are some of ways that we aim to do this:
- Year 2 Rotary Club Maths Competition
- Year 4 Rotary Club Maths Competition
- year 6 Rotary Writing Competitions
- Spelling Bees
- School Council debates
- St. Luke's has got Talent - musical performances
- Sing-a-long events
- Young Voices - an opportunity to sing at the O2 in London
- Writing Competitions where children have the chance to have their work published in a book
- Aspiring talks e.g. Judge, Olympians, Theresa May
- Art Workshops with specialist teachers
- Art, Science and Computing projects with Independent and Secondary School
- Shakespeare drama workshops and annual performances
- Dance Festivals
- Norden Farm Workshops
- Star of the Week/Day
- WOW boards - showcasing work in the classroom
- Sport Champions - Year 6 pupils encouraging children to take part in a range of sports
- MISH MASH music showcase - sharing musical talents with local schools
- Celebration Assemblies every Friday
- Invictus Sporting Events
- Art Galleries - publishing art work around the school
- Sports Days and competitions
- Hot Chocolate with the Headteacher
- Well done emails and calls home
